
The Tranquil Developers You Selects IPL 2025 (Exhibition) Eliminator at DCS You Selects Arena 1, Rahmaniyah, Sharjah, saw a clinical performance from Jallus Foodstuffs Thrissur Legends, who outplayed VDS Indore Chargers by six wickets. With fiery bowling from Shahir Mohammed and Leander Daryl Paul, followed by an explosive counterattack led by Jereesh Jalaludeen, the Legends stormed into the next round with style and swagger.


Batting first, Indore Chargers struggled to build momentum against a disciplined Thrissur attack. Skipper Nitin Jain (C) opted to bat, but early wickets derailed their plans. Opener Rahul Chauhan (24 off 15) started briskly, but wickets fell at regular intervals as Leander Daryl Paul (2/17) and Shahir Mohammed (2/28) ripped through the middle order. The Chargers’ resistance came from Deepak Rao (33 off 32), who mixed patience with precision before holing out to deep midwicket. Late cameos from Ashif Amla (21 off 16)* provided a modest finish, as the Chargers were bundled out for 114 in 17.4 overs.
Thrissur’s bowlers were relentless — Leander bowled with exceptional rhythm, hitting consistent lengths, while Shahir’s variations broke the backbone of Indore’s batting. Supporting them, Shamz (2/12) and Sreenath K (1/16) ensured there was no easy escape route. Their fielding was sharp too — Linesh took two vital catches, including a blinder to dismiss Rahul Chauhan off Sreenath’s bowling, keeping Indore under constant pressure.


Chasing 115, Thrissur Legends wasted no time asserting dominance. Despite losing Prasanth Asokan (14 off 11) and Linesh (1 off 4) early, wicketkeeper-batter Jereesh Jalaludeen launched a brutal counterattack. His 41 off just 20 balls — featuring four boundaries and three massive sixes — completely shifted momentum. When he departed at 76/3, Sreenath K (22 off 19) and Shahir Mohammed (24 off 11)* carried the assault forward. Shahir’s finishing touch, including two sixes over long-on, sealed the chase in just 12.1 overs, securing an emphatic six-wicket victory.
This match was a statement of intent from the Legends — their bowling was clinical, batting fearless, and fielding sharp. Indore, on the other hand, struggled with both tempo and application. Their decision to bat first backfired as they couldn’t counter Thrissur’s bowling precision or match their power-hitting intensity.
